WebA wetsuit is the minimum protection needed for those conditions. Typically made of a thick neoprene, it insulates you by holding a thin layer of water (heated by your body) next to your skin. A dry suit is for colder water (and air). Made of a waterproof material, it also has watertight gaskets at the openings to keep you completely dry. WebWhen temperatures are very cold, wet systems leave paddlers chilled. When air temperatures are high, it’s hard to stay cool in a wetsuit unless you deliberately jump into the water. Dry systems address both of these problems. Dry systems rely on a drysuit that prevents water from touching your skin. WebIf the water temperature is 50F (10C), a 2mm wetsuit will protect you from cold shock, but it won't delay incapacitation for very long. If you wear a wetsuit, be sure it provides you with enough protection for the conditions in which you paddle. That's why we advise you to swim-test and field-test your gear.
